Transaction a5ab7dd231d74b0863841f627d96f044a56b2d65e828868e3e4d48459e77bf80

52 Input
2 Outputs
  • a5ab7dd231d74b0863841f627d96f044a56b2d65e828868e3e4d48459e77bf80:0
  • value  502550112
    address  3M8XhbsLYEuk1Ewjnux7rmhAdjk9RaybsL
  • a5ab7dd231d74b0863841f627d96f044a56b2d65e828868e3e4d48459e77bf80:1
  • value  942330
    address  3JajUty76hU8scEdbceJX8ZbxTHSoKQGDX